How much do entry level civil engineering outsourcing j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 6, 2026, the average yearly pay for entry level civil engineering outsourcing in the United States is $73,528.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$52,000.00 and $88,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

How to become an entry level civil engineering outsourcing with no experience?

To pursue an entry-level civil engineering outsourcing role with no experience, focus on gaining foundational knowledge through online courses or certifications in civil engineering principles and software like AutoCAD or Civil 3D. Internships, volunteering, or entry-level positions can provide practical exposure, and developing skills in project documentation and basic surveying can improve employability in outsourcing projects.

Why is it so hard to find an entry-level civil engineering outsourcing job?

Entry-level civil engineering outsourcing jobs are often limited due to high competition, the need for specific skills such as proficiency in design software and knowledge of construction standards, and employers' preference for experienced candidates. Additionally, outsourcing roles may require certifications or licenses, which can be barriers for new graduates seeking entry-level positions.
